The demand for Alma Cola soft drink at Daisy Supermarket is 200 bottles every week. The setup cost for placing an order to replenish inventory is $12. The order is delivered by the Alma Cola supplier, which, for the cost of transportation, charges $0.05/bottle. That increases the cost of the drink to $1.15/bottle. The drink loses its freshness while stored at Daisy Supermarket. The annual holding cost is $2.3/bottle.
Determine how often the supermarket should order Alma Cola and what the size of each order should be. Explain how you have used the formula with the data given.
